GoodWe inverters now at IBC SOLAR

System house extends product portfolio within the European market with a new partnership

Bad Staffelstein / Germany, July 02, 2020 – IBC SOLAR AG, a global leader in photovoltaic (PV) systems and energy storage is expanding their portfolio with high-quality inverters from the manufacturer GoodWe. The company is currently one of the emerging manufacturers in the inverter market and has a strong focus on a sustainable and locally oriented sales structure. Through the partnership, IBC SOLAR provides its customers with an even larger selection of quality inverters.

Customers can now also purchase GoodWe's inverters from IBC SOLAR. The company is one of the leading manufacturers of photovoltaic inverters and energy storage solutions. In May this year GoodWe was named by Wood Mackenzie as the world's No. 1 manufacturer of hybrid inverters - one of the company's core competencies.

GoodWe's inverters are extremely competitive for both home and commercial use. With an average monthly sales volume of around 30,000 units and an installed capacity of 12 gigawatts (GW) in over 80 countries, GoodWe inverters are used worldwide.
